A Gathering of Mission-Driven Health Leaders
We proudly invite you to the2025 Annual Conference, October 7–8, at the Terre Haute Convention Center. This year’s theme, “The Heart of Health Care,” celebrates the central role that community health centers and frontline providers play in delivering compassionate, comprehensive care to Hoosiers across the state.
The conference brings together professionals from across Indiana passionate about improving access to and quality of primary care. This year’s event will focus on the people and practices that keep communities healthy, emphasizing collaboration, excellence, and sustainable care models.

Suggested Topics for Educational Sessions
We encourage proposals that speak to the heart and science of patient care and sustaining operations to align with this theme. These sessions should inform, inspire, and empower attendees to bring both heart and excellence to their work in every community across Indiana.
Potential topics include:
- Strengthening Care Teams:
Supporting collaboration, well-being, and workforce engagement - Whole Person Care:
Integrating behavioral, physical, and social health - Advancing Health Access for All:
Practical approaches to reducing disparities in care - Community-Based Innovation:
Programs that respond directly to local needs - Patient Trust and Engagement:
Best practices for building meaningful connections with patients - Sustainable Care Models:
Preparing for future changes in funding and service delivery - Value-Based Care:
Adapting to new payment models and care delivery systems - Leadership for Impact:
Growing skills and resilience among clinical and administrative leaders
- Technology with Heart:
Using data and digital tools without losing the personal touch - Public Policy and Advocacy:
Navigating legislative changes and funding priorities - Developing the Workforce:
Recruiting, preparing, and retaining the next generation of health professionals - Optimizing Clinic Workflows:
Strategies to improve efficiency, reduce wait times, and enhance the patient experience - Data-Driven Decision Making:
Using reporting tools and performance metrics to strengthen clinic operations and outcomes - Maximizing Resources in Rural Clinics:
Practical strategies for managing limited staff, space, and funding while maintaining high quality care.
